The Department of the Interior and Local Government (DILG) proposed a “buy one, give one” program where they will purchase an additional police vehicle for every unit bought by Metro Manila local government units.
This initiative aims to improve the police vehicle-to-population ratio in the National Capital Region, which currently has fewer police vehicles compared to less populous areas like Cavite.
DILG Secretary Benjamin Remulla emphasized that the plan aligns with President Marcos Jr.’s directive to strengthen emergency and crisis response nationwide.
The agency also plans to buy more police motorcycles to address the gap in riding competency among officers and mini fire trucks for better access in narrow urban areas.
Recently, DILG supported greener law enforcement by facilitating the turnover of 41 electric vehicles to Valenzuela City under the 2024 Local Government Support Fund.
